THE BASICS:
Score: Roger Williams 149, Wesleyan 139
Location: Bristol, R.I. (Aquatics Center)
Date: Saturday, January 14th
Time: 1 p.m.
The Lead: In a meet that came down to the last relay event, the Wesleyan University men's swimming and diving team were edged out by Roger Williams by a score of 149-139 on Saturday afternoon.
SWIMMING HIGHLIGHTS:
- Aidan Winn '18 claimed first place in both the 500 and 1,000 free events. Winn came from behind to win the 500 with a time of 4:58.03, and captured first in the 1,000 with a mark of 10:20.37. Teammate Peter Patapis '18 finished second to Winn in the 1,000 event with a time of 10:27.58.
- Quinn Tucker '20 also came from behind to win the 200 freestyle in 1:45.87 which is his best time of the season so far.
- Spencer Tang '18 captured first place in both the 100 backstroke event and the 100 butterfly event with times of 55.26 and 54.54 respectively.
- Ali Pourmaleki '18 came back to win the 200m backstroke event with his best ever time of 1:56.20. He also came out victorious in the 200m fly with a time of 1:58.77. Max Distler '18 finished second in the event with a time of 2:03.11.
DIVING HIGHLIGHTS:
- Ethan Chupp '18 won both the 1 and 3 meter diving events with scores of 239.61 and 217.28 respectively.
